Drug Use and Abuse, International Edition
Explore the complexities of substance use with Drug Use and Abuse, International Edition by Stephen A. Maisto. This comprehensive text, published by Cengage Learning in 2010, spans 512 pages and is now in its 6th edition. Maisto takes an interdisciplinary approach to drug issues, highlighting how a drug's effects are influenced not just by its inherent properties, but also by the biological and psychological traits of the user. The book delves into individual classes of drugs, offering insightful discussions on pharmacology and psychopharmacology.
